When a failed baseball player's ex-girlfriend moves back to the neighborhood with her seven-year-old daughter, he realizes he carries more regrets than how he handled his baseball career. What follows is his earnest, awkward, and at times hilarious fight to become the father he never was. Written by Anonymous
The Quitter is a story about a man who ran from both his baseball career and his pregnant wife. When he one day by chance bumps into his ex-girlfriend and their daughter he tries to make amends for running out on them.
What I like about this movie is the genuine feel it has, the actor's are not hollywood stars with perfect looks and the characters have their flaws, but they do their best to make life work, one step at a time. Great acting by Matthew and Juliana Bonefacio and a brilliant performance by Dierdre O'Connel (Jonathan's mother) make this film well worth watching.
